ABOUT THE FOUNDATION

The Cathedral School Educational Foundation is a non-profit 501(c)(3) entity. It is the
implementation arm of the Cathedral School Alumni Association.

The Foundation is responsible for working with Cathedral Catholic School and the
Catholic Educational Secretariat in identifying the needs of the school and ensuring an
effective means of delivering support. It operates on a budget approved annually by the
National Association at the convention plenary session.
